I don't see it as GM pulling strings, rather GM investing early allocations into cars they know will give them free advertising and a large audience they would not otherwise have. What makes more sense? give an early allocation to a car that will be seen all over the internet and get real world test data, or to some collector whos going to stuff it in his garage and probably never drive the thing because its "one of the first"? From GM's perspective these influencers are going to put that car in front of a different audience than the typical Corvette buyer. No not all of that audience is in a position to buy the car now, but GM is playing a long game. They want to keep selling Corvettes 10 years from now. They know the average Corvette buyer is nearing their golden years and they have to expand their marketing to a younger generation. The best way to do that is through free advertising via youtube, tiktok, instagram, and the like. The early allocation to the influencer cost GM nothing but gains them tons in hype and future revenue. It keeps Corvette going for generations to come.

IMHO, the Z06 has been oversold already with people getting all excited because of the sound. So far from what I have seen too many people got on lists they may not be able to afford the car or it really is to much of a track oriented car. But the reality is this is a high revving car made for the track. If one thinks the Z06 is going to be fun driving in the low rev range they have another thing coming. Probably for most people the C8 Stingray is a better choice--Certainly dollar for dollar. Yes I can't wait for my Z06/Z07 but I hope the production cycle is long enough to be able to get the car especially since I will exclusively use it for the track.

Maybe GM is trying to properly set expectations of the Z06 since I believe many people have unrealistic expectations of what the car actually is.
